What is Requiem for the Dead: American Spring 2014 about? Toggle content

Requiem for the Dead: American Spring 2014 is a powerful and moving documentary that sheds light on the devastating impact of gun violence in the United States. Through a series of poignant and heart-wrenching stories, the film remembers the lives of over 8,000 people who were killed by gunfire in the spring of 2014, including victims of accidental shootings, random acts of violence, family disputes, and suicide. Using a combination of social media posts, 9-1-1 calls, news stories, and police files, directors Nick Doob and Shari Cookson have created a film that is both deeply personal and profoundly disturbing. By sharing the stories of those who have been lost to gun violence, Requiem for the Dead: American Spring 2014 offers a powerful tribute to those who have been killed and a urgent call to action to prevent such tragedies from happening again in the future.
